Lone Star NYE at Reunion Tower
On December 31, 2025, at 11:59 p.m., Reunion Tower will host its tenth annual Lone Star NYE fireworks show. The event features over 5,000 pyrotechnic effects, a 259 LED light display, and a drone show, creating a spectacular visual experience. Free to the public, this event emphasizes community togetherness and celebration.
Crown Block Dinner Experience
For a premium experience, Crown Block offers two dinner seatings atop Reunion Tower:
- Sunset Seating at 5:30 p.m.: Enjoy a limited à la carte menu with panoramic views as the sun sets over Dallas.
- NYE Celebration Seating at 8:00 p.m.: Indulge in a festive multi-course dinner, specialty cocktails, and front-row views of the fireworks display.
Reservations are recommended.
Crown Room NYE Ball
The Crown Room inside Reunion Tower hosts an exclusive NYE Ball from 8:30 p.m. to 12:30 a.m. The event includes gourmet food stations, signature cocktails, a live DJ, dancing, and unmatched views of Dallas’ fireworks. Tickets are priced at $325 per person, reflecting a high-end social experience this New Year’s Eve.
Emerald City Band’s Rock 25 New Year’s Eve Party at the Hilton Anatole
Celebrate at the Hilton Anatole’s Chantilly Ballroom with live music from the Emerald City Band and a DJ. Tickets start at $95 per person, which provides a lively environment for attendees looking to enjoy music and dance.
New Year’s Eve at the Meyerson Symphony Center
Enjoy a live concert featuring classical favorites like Suppé’s Overture to Light Calvary and Strauss’ On the Blue Danube Waltzes. The evening begins at 7:30 p.m., with tickets starting at $63, presenting an elegant cultural option for music enthusiasts.
Royal Masquerade Ball at The Statler
Experience a glamorous evening with a full casino and complimentary champagne at The Statler’s Royal Masquerade Ball. Tickets start at $150, appealing to those seeking a high-class, festive vibe.
High Fantasy NYE: Pink Pony Pub at House of Blues
Step into a whimsical world at the House of Blues Foundation Room’s High Fantasy NYE: Pink Pony Pub. Tickets are available starting at $75, catering to attendees looking for a unique and imaginative celebration.
New Year’s Eve with Felix Da Housecat at It’ll Do Club
Dance the night away with Felix Da Housecat at It’ll Do Club. Doors open at 8 p.m., and tickets start at $25, offering an affordable nightlife option for younger crowds and electronic music fans.
New Year’s Eve with Little Joe y la Familia at Longhorn Ballroom
Enjoy the popular Tex-Mex band Little Joe & La Familia at the legendary Longhorn Ballroom. Tickets start at $30, highlighting the cultural diversity that makes Dallas unique.
New Year’s Eve at FIVEE Bistro & Bar
Dance the night away at FIVEE on Botham Jean Blvd. on December 31. Tickets start at $25, providing a casual setting for those looking to celebrate without the formalities of larger events.
New Year’s Day 5K & Fun Run
Begin your resolutions on New Year’s Day with an exciting outdoor adventure. The New Year’s Day 5K and Fun Run feature a 5K race and a one-mile journey on the Santa Fe Trail. Participants receive rewards such as a commemorative long sleeve shirt and a finisher medal. This event includes a post-race brunch at White Rock Alehouse and Brewery, featuring a pass for breakfast tacos, mimosas, and beers for participants 21 years and older.
